Question 819904: Find the amount of money in account after 6 years if $4500 is deposited at 7% annual interest compounded quarterly.
Answer by ewatrrr(24785)   (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
 
Hi, In General
A = Accumulated Amount
P= principal = 4500
r= annual rate = .07
n= periods per year = 4
t= years = 6
